Address 0 PPC

PRUdHkXvULbrs4LAadVciM3h86oycxvckk

Confirmed

Total Received5.829295 PPC
Total Sent5.829295 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PRUdHkXvULbrs4LAadVciM3h86oycxvckk5.829295 PPC
Fee: 0.01 PPC
657681 Confirmations5.819295 PPC
PRUdHkXvULbrs4LAadVciM3h86oycxvckk5.829295 PPC
PPvcRJRbDbsvUxLPcSWiBXt59ehPnC8EjP0.258967 PPC
Fee: 0.01 PPC
657682 Confirmations6.088262 PPC